Aged 75 years.
---------------------------
According to her obit, she was born in Sneen, County Kerry, Ireland.
Married Daniel Sweeney in Boston, Massachusetts. Soon after there marriage they came to Morgan County, IL.
They had five children: Miles, Daniel, Jeremiah, Mary, and Annie.
Her son, Miles Sweeney at the age of 12, left Jacksonville with the 101st Illinois Volunteers, and hasn't been seen since. Her son, Captain Daniel E. Sweeney, was associated with the Russell Brothers; Jeremiah Sweeney was a merchant policeman; daughters: Mrs. Jeremiah (Mary) Mahoney of Peoria and Mrs. Michael (Annie) Mahoney of Jacksonville.
Also survived by one sister, Mrs. Julia Sullivan of Chicago.
Source of maiden name:
Calvary Cemetery listing on rootsweb.
Jacksonville Daily Journal, March 13, 1901
